Ravenwood by Danik
You are a lone cat, finding yourself in an unfamiliar place scattered with mysterious glowing orbs.
Arrows to move, Z or Up to jump, X or down to claw.
Unfortunately I didn't have time to add a satisfying ending, the current one leaves a lot to the imagination. I will add a better ending in a future version.
NOTE: Beware of flashing lights!
